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Start by preheating your oven to 425°F.

While it warms up, line a large sheet pan with parchment paper.

This little trick makes cleanup a breeze and ensures your chicken doesn’t stick.

Setting the stage for a perfect bake is key!

Step 2: Season the Chicken

In a large bowl, toss your bite-sized chicken pieces with olive oil and the spices.

Add gar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, salt, black pepper, and cayenne if you’re feeling adventurous.

Make sure every piece is coated well.

This is where the flavor begins to build!

Step 3: Arrange on the Sheet Pan

Spread the seasoned chicken evenly on the prepared sheet pan.

Now, add the halved cherry tomatoes and diced cucumber around the chicken.

This not only looks great but also allows for even cooking and flavor infusion.

Trust me, your taste buds will thank you!

Step 4: Bake to Perfection

Slide the sheet pan into your preheated oven and bake for 20-25 minutes.

You’ll know it’s done when the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.

This is where the magic happens, and your kitchen will smell absolutely amazing!

Step 5: Prepare the Herby Ranch Slaw

While the chicken is baking, grab another bowl and mix together the shredded cabbage, red onion, parsley, dill, and ranch dressing.

Toss everything until well combined.

This slaw adds a fresh crunch that perfectly complements the warm chicken.

Step 6: Assemble the Pitas

Once the chicken is cooked, remove the sheet pan from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es.

Cut each whole wheat pita in half and fill them with the chicken mixture and herby ranch slaw.

This final step is where all the flavors come together for a delicious meal!

Can I make the chicken ahead of time? Absolutely! You can season the chicken and store it in the fridge for up to 24 hours before baking. This makes it even easier to whip up these Sheet Pan Chicken Pitas with Herby Ranch Slaw on a busy night.

What can I substitute for ranch dressing? If you’re looking for a lighter option, try using a yogurt-based dressing or a vinaigrette. Both will add a delicious twist to the herby ranch slaw.

How do I store leftovers? Store any leftover chicken and slaw in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at the chicken in the oven or microwave before assembling your pitas again.

Can I use other vegetables? Definitely! Feel free to mix in your favorite veggies like bell peppers, zucchini, or even corn. The more colorful, the better!

Is this recipe suitable for meal prep? Yes! These Sheet Pan Chicken Pitas with Herby Ranch Slaw are perfect for meal prep. Just pack the chicken and slaw separately, and assemble when you’re ready to eat.

Sheet Pan Chicken Pitas with Herby Ranch Slaw delight!

A delicious and easy recipe for Sheet Pan Chicken Pitas with Herby Ranch Slaw, perfect for a quick weeknight dinner.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: American
Calories: 450

Ingredients
  

  • 2 large chicken breasts about 1 pound,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per optional
  • 4 whole wheat pitas
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es halved
  • 1 cup cucumber diced
  • 1/2 red onion thinly sliced
  • 1 cup shredded green cabbage
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ley chopped
  • 1/4 cup fresh dill chopped
  • 1/2 cup ranch dressing

Method
 

  1. Preheat the oven to 425°F. Line a large sheet pan with parchment paper.
  2. In a large bowl, combine the chicken pieces, olive oil,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per (if using). Toss until the chicken is well coated.
  3. Spread the seasoned chicken evenly on the prepared sheet pan. Add the cherry tomatoes and cucumber around the chicken.
  4.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.
  5. While the chicken is baking, prepare the herby ranch slaw. In a large bowl, combine the shredded cabbage, red onion, parsley, dill, and ranch dressing. Toss until well mixed.
  6. Once the chicken is done, remove the sheet pan from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es.
  7. To assemble the pitas, cut each pita in half and fill with the chicken mixture and herby ranch slaw. Serve immediately.
